(MEMPHIS) - Indiana's balanced scoring was too much for a makeshift Memphis Grizzlies lineup. Malcolm Brogdon scored 19 points, Domantas Sabonis added 18 and the Pacers beat the depleted Grizzlies 117-104 on Monday night. Seven players scored in double figures for the Pacers, including Myles Turner with 17 points. Jeremy Lamb and reserve Justin Holiday had 15 apiece, with Holiday missing only one of his six 3-point attempts. Ball movement has become the key for the Pacers, who have won six of seven. Their passing and cutting provided open shots, and Indiana capitalized by shooting 50% from the field and hitting 16 of 38 3-pointers (42%). Jaren Jackson Jr. led Memphis with a season-high 31 points. Solomon Brooks finished with 19 on 7-of-16 shooting. The Grizzlies were short-handed as four players, all key parts of the rotation, sat out with various ailments.
